Transaction 6d62cfc53c5643180f274a039314c4bc0206f561871ee6a74e30a010edc32e80
1 Input
1 Output
-
6d62cfc53c5643180f274a039314c4bc0206f561871ee6a74e30a010edc32e80:0
- value
- 566900
- script pubkey
- OP_0 OP_PUSHBYTES_20 da4b1c8ca9cacbe81aed5bf58fd92b31e996aa31
- address
- bc1qmf93er9fet97sxhdt06clkftx85ed233ayl2tj